Introduces the Christian tradition according to what the Christian Church has believed, taught, and confessed on the basis of the Word of God. Focuses on the historical and doctrinal. Serves the Apostles' Creed and the Nazarene Articles of Faith as models by surveying the historical and doctrinal foci of the Christian tradition. Prerequisites: BL110, CP210, CP295, and Junior standing. Offered fall and spring, often in summer.
